
Kako naučiti programiranje?
Programiranje je postalo jedna od najvažnijih veština u današnjem digitalnom svetu. Omogućava vam da kreirate softver, pravite sajtove i rešavate stvarne probleme. Međutim, može biti zbunjujuće ako ste početnik. U ovom postu preći ćemo nekoliko saveta kako efikasno naučiti programiranje.
1. Razumite osnove
Od suštinskog je značaja da razumete osnovne koncepte programiranja. Ovi koncepti su osnova i pomoći će vam da razumete kako kod radi.
Osnovni koncepti programiranja uključuju sledeće:
Razumevanje ovih koncepata omogućava vam da pišete kod koji rešava prave probleme.
2. Izaberite programski jezik
Sledeći korak je izbor programskog jezika. Dostupno je mnogo različitih jezika, a neki od najpopularnijih su:
Ako niste sigurni odakle da počnete, preporučujemo učenje Python-a. Python ima jednostavnu sintaksu i koristi se u mnogim industrijama, uključujući veštačku inteligenciju.
3. Postavite ciljeve
Pre nego što počnete, važno je postaviti ciljeve. Jasna ideja će vas održati motivisanim i fokusiranim.
Vaši ciljevi treba da budu specifični i ostvarivi. Na primer, kreiranje jednostavnog kalkulatora, izrada sajta pomoću HTML-a i CSS-a ili pisanje Python skripte.
4. Pronađite resurse
Postoji mnogo dostupnih resursa koji vam mogu pomoći da naučite programiranje. Evo nekih popularnih opcija:
5. Vežba, vežba i samo vežba
Vežbanje je ključno. Što više vežbate, bićete bolji.
Počnite sa jednostavnim vežbama, poput kreiranja programa 'Hello, World!'. Kasnije možete preći na kompleksnije projekte.
Efikasan način za vežbanje jeste učestvovanje u programerskim izazovima na platformama kao što je HackerRank.
6. Pridružite se zajednici
Pridruživanje programerskoj zajednici može biti neverovatno korisno. Možete postavljati pitanja i dobiti povratne informacije o svom kôdu.
Neke od popularnih online zajednica su Learn Programming na Reddit-u, Stack Overflow i GitHub.
7. Pravite projekte
Pravljenje sopstvenih projekata je jedan od najefikasnijih načina da naučite programiranje. Projekti vam pomažu da primenite koncepte na stvarne probleme.
Počnite sa jednostavnim projektima. Zatim možete preći na kompleksnije zadatke, poput kreiranja igre ili web aplikacije.
8. Potražite kritiku i povratne informacije
Povratne informacije o vašem kôdu su ključne za napredak. Konstruktivna kritika iskusnijih programera vam pomaže da uvidite gde grešite.
Jedan način je da učestvujete u 'Code review' procesima gde drugi programeri pregledaju vaš kod.
9. Nastavite sa učenjem
Učenje programiranja je proces koji traje. Stalno se pojavljuju nove tehnologije i programski jezici.
Steknite naviku da svakog dana naučite nešto novo. To može biti čitanje članka ili gledanje tutorijala.
10. Ostanite motivisani
Učenje programiranja može biti izazovno, pa je važno ostati motivisan. Setite se zašto ste uopšte počeli.
Jedan način je da radite na projektima koji vama lično nešto znače.
Drugi način je da pratite svoj napredak. Postavite sebi ciljeve i proslavite kada ih ostvarite.
Programiranje je izazovno, ali nagrađujuće iskustvo. Uz ove savete, moći ćete efikasno da učite. Srećno na vašem programerskom putovanju!
Pre nego što počnete sa učenjem programiranja, savetujemo vam da isprobate naš online test 'Da li je programiranje za tebe', gde možete proveriti svoj programerski potencijal. URADI TEST→

